About Mary-Joe

Mary-Joe Renaud practises civil litigation, insurance defence, personal injury, and commercial litigation. Renaud graduated from the University of Windsor's Faculty of Law in 2004 and was called to the Ontario Bar in February 2005. During law school Renaud received several awards, including the Faculty of Law Entrance Award, the Criminal Trial Advocacy Award, the Labour Law Award, the Justice Thomas Zuber Mooting Award, and the Harold G. Fox Bursary. Renaud belongs to the Canadian Bar Association, the Essex Law Association, the Canadian Defence Lawyers Association, and the Ontario Insurance Adjusters Association.
